Growth protocol Cells were maintained in DMEM (Invitrogen, Carlsbad, CA), supplemented with 10% fetal bovine serum (FBS) (PAA Australia, Weike Biochemical Reagent, Shanghai, China), 1% penicillin/streptomycin and 10 μg/mL ciprofloxacin.
Extracted molecule polyA RNA
Extraction protocol RNC extraction: Esposito AM, Mateyak M, He D, Lewis M, Sasikumar AN, Hutton J, Copeland PR, Kinzy TG. 2010. Eukaryotic polyribosome profile analysis. J Vis Exp(40). RNA extraction: standard Trizol protocol.
Standard Illumina TruSeq mRNA library prep
 
Library strategy RNA-Seq
Library source transcriptomic
Library selection cDNA
Instrument model Illumina HiSeq 2000
 
Description total mRNA of H1299
Data processing Reads were mapped to RefSeq RNA reference sequence using FANSe v7.2 with the options –L78 –S8 –I0 –E9 –B1.
Splice variants were summed
The reads mapped to splice variants of one gene were summed. The mRNA abundance was calculated using rpkM (reads per kilobase per million reads) normalization (Mortazavi et al. 2008)
